Transaction 72372173aa0ccc03e060a1f86eccba604b51fe1617af90276107563732fc849d

1 Input
2 Outputs
  • 72372173aa0ccc03e060a1f86eccba604b51fe1617af90276107563732fc849d:0
  • value  2481590
    address  3BR83cU4DvChfY36YP3fSR9oeLUrrQso5g
  • 72372173aa0ccc03e060a1f86eccba604b51fe1617af90276107563732fc849d:1
  • value  1679226
    address  3HTU5FHgNjeM4EqBrgRcpudDPheftSKJTk